✦ Synopsis


A simple and effective synthesis of 3,4-dihydropyrimidinone derivatives from aldehydes, 1,3-dicarbonyl compounds, and urea/thiourea in ethanol by using calcium fluoride as catalyst has been described. Compared with classical Biginelli reaction conditions, this new method has the advantage of excellent yields and shorter reaction times. Also, the catalyst can be reused without any reduction in efficiency.
